Question
Like term as 4m3n2 is ______.
Options
4m2n2
– 6m3n2
6pm3n2
4m3n
Advertisements
Solution
Like term as 4m3n2 is – 6m3n2.
Explanation:
We know that, the like terms contain the same literal factor.
So, the like term as 4m3n2, is – 6m3n2, as it contains the same literal factor m3n2.
